Hi

I successfully installed ocropus ver 0.4.4 on Ubuntu 10.10 by
following instructions at http://code.google.com/p/ocropus/wiki/InstallTranscript

When running ocropus-ctrain I encountered an error
optparse.OptionConflictError: option -R/--rejectfactor: conflicting
option string(s): -R
There were two instances of -R so I replaced the second -R with -f.

I created a chars.db database after following the necessary
preliminary training steps. However when I run the command

ocropus-ctrain -K 10 chars.db -o chars.cmodel

I get the error
# determining per-class cutoff
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"/usr/local/bin/ocropus-ctrain", line 189, in <module>
ntrain = int(stats.scoreatpercentile(counts,threshold))
File "/usr/lib/python2.7/dist-packages/scipy/stats/stats.py", line
1287, in scoreatpercentile
return _interpolate(values[int(idx)], values[int(idx) + 1], idx %
1)
IndexError: index out of bounds

Can someone send a fixed recent version working version of ocropus-
ctrain to the group?

Well

I'm replying to myself. I retried the command after editing the
chars.db file with ocropus-cedit and it worked. I suppose there were
some classes that hadn't been classified?
Is this a requirement before running ocropus-ctrain?
